In the 1990 IPCC report it talks about “greenhouse gasses” and also about “air pollution” but treats those as two distinct things: https://www.ipcc.ch/site/assets/uploads/2018/05/ipcc_90_92_a.... For example, on page 97, it says “CO2 enrichment” may “enhance plant growth,” but that “enhanced levels of air pollution could also reduce this positive effect.” There’s it’s clearly talking about CO2 and air pollution as two different things that have opposite effects on plant growth.
